  • What are the cheapest neighborhoods to find a room for rent in Cambridge?

    Mid-Cambridge, West Cambridge, Riverside, and North Cambridge usually price below the citywide average, and Cambridge Highlands and Strawberry Hill can surprise you if you are willing to sit a little further from a T stop. East Cambridge and Cambridgeport sit at the expensive end thanks to Kendall Square demand. Stepping just over the line into Somerville or Allston typically knocks a few hundred dollars off the same room, and you often keep the same commute.

  • How much does a room for rent in Cambridge cost per month?

    Most rooms in Cambridge go for $1,300 to $1,600 a month, with the full market running roughly $950 up to $2,200 depending on the square, the size of the room, and whether it is furnished. Utilities usually add $60-$80 per person. Worth knowing: splitting a two-bedroom here works out to about $1,900-$2,100 each, so taking a room in an existing household commonly saves $400-$800 every month.

  • Are there rooms for rent in Cambridge with no broker fee?

    Yes, and most of them. Roomster listings come straight from the landlord or the housemates, so there is no agent in the middle taking a cut. Massachusetts law also changed on August 1, 2025: a landlord can no longer pass their own broker's fee to you. The fee falls on whoever hired the broker, so unless you engaged one yourself, you should not be paying it.

  • Are furnished rooms for rent available in Cambridge?

    Plenty. Furnished rooms cluster around Harvard, MIT, Lesley University, and the Kendall Square labs, because the demand comes from visiting researchers, postdocs, and contract staff at places like Takeda, Moderna, and Novartis who arrive for a semester or a project rather than a full year. Filter for furnished on Roomster and you will also surface most of the June through August sublets, which almost always come move-in ready.

  • How do I find a room for rent near Harvard, MIT, or Kendall Square?

    Search by square rather than by street, then sanity check it against the Red Line, since it is the spine of the whole city: Alewife, Porter, Harvard, Central, and Kendall/MIT run in a straight shot into downtown Boston. A room in Central Square puts you one stop from Kendall and one from Harvard, which is why it stays in demand. Porter adds commuter rail on the Fitchburg Line if you head out of the city regularly, and Davis Square in Somerville is a short hop for anyone priced out of Harvard Square.

What to Compare Before Renting a Room

  • Budget considerations: Rooms closer to transit or downtown areas often come at a premium. Furnished and utilities-included rooms might cost more but add convenience.
  • Lease terms: Clarify if the room is available for short term, sublease, or month-to-month rental to match your move-in timing and flexibility needs.
  • Screening requirements: Expect security deposits and possible credit or address checks as part of the rental process.
  • Bathroom and amenities: Private bathrooms add privacy but may increase cost; shared bathrooms are common in house shares.

How to Avoid Common Room Rental Mistakes in Cambridge, MA

  • confirm listing authenticity: Use Roomster’s ID check and address check tools to confirm the legitimacy of listings.
  • Be cautious with payments: Avoid wiring money or paying deposits before an in-person or screened virtual meeting with the landlord or current tenants.
  • Ask detailed questions: Confirm lease terms, included utilities, and house rules before committing.
  • Meet roommates if possible: Ensure lifestyle compatibility and clarify expectations around guests, noise, and cleanliness.
